Question
I have 2 pair of sps-600 alpine speakers and a mrp-f300 alpine amp and they just dont sound that good I have had the amp tuned and checked by the people who installed it. I have a Toyota Tundra double cab 2006 truck should i have bought a little larger amp or different speakers just dont like the sound and have spent money on this have any suggestion?

Answer
Larry, I do not understand what is the problem.  Sound quality? or Sound loudness?  If the sound quality is not up to par, you may want to upgrade to a better speaker.  Normally, just about any aftermarket speaker will outperform a factory speaker, but sometimes there are a few that don't measure up.  To fix that, I would suggest looking into MB Quart or Polk Audio.  If they are not loud enough, then you should look into a more powerful amp.  As long as you buy a namebrand amp, it should sound fine.  Just get one with the power you are looking for.  Then get speakers to match the rms power of the amp.  If you are looking for more bass response in your system, it will require a subwoofer and sub amp to create the lower frequencies.  Hope this helps, Scott
